"Looking Back, There Were Moments That Were Not Admirable" ... Candid Confession
"Even If We're Not Cool, Let's Live Our Own Lives"
Actress Han So-hee (32) attracted attention by posting a message that seemed to reflect on past personal life controversies and express her feelings.
On the 11th, Han So-hee wrote a lengthy post on her blog, stating, "Since the past shapes the present, I often look back myself. When I think about it, there were moments that were not admirable, and most of the things I was sure were right were not." She added, "I try not to be obsessed with that."
She continued, "I always strive to move in a better direction, but like the saying 'A sparrow trying to follow a stork ends up tearing its thighs,' these days I try to spend my days according to my limits and capabilities."
She said, "I cannot insist on being the best and doing my best every time," and added, "Although I have laid out fancy words, what I have been trying to say all along seems to be 'Let's live our lives even if we're not that cool.'"
Han So-hee tagged the post with hashtags such as 'Pretending to have lived life fully,' 'Moved by myself,' and 'Trying to teach when my own nose is three feet long.' She also attached a photo of a notice on a broken ATM machine that read, "We apologize for the inconvenience. We will fix our bad manners as soon as possible."
This is interpreted as her stance on the personal life controversies surrounding her. Han So-hee revealed her relationship with actor Ryu Jun-yeol in March last year, but broke up two weeks later amid so-called 'transfer dating' suspicions related to singer and actress Hyeri, who was Ryu Jun-yeol’s ex-girlfriend.
At that time, when Hyeri, who had been publicly dating Ryu Jun-yeol since 2017, posted "Interesting" on social media, Han So-hee responded with "I find it interesting too," which escalated the controversy.
Meanwhile, Han So-hee said, "My blog is a truly warm communication channel for me," and promised, "Although I cannot come often, after finishing filming a movie and taking a vacation, I will try to communicate with you all as often as possible."
She also urged her fans, saying, "What I feel as I get older is that health is the most important," and added, "Let's not get sick and meet again."
